use chrono::Duration;
pub fn parse_age(s: &str) -> Option<Duration> {
let s = s.trim();
if s.is_empty() {
return None;
}
let split = s.find(|c: char| c.is_alphabetic()).unwrap_or(s.len());
let (num_part, unit) = s.split_at(split);
let n: i64 = num_part.trim().parse().ok()?;
if n < 0 {
return None;
}
let days = match unit.trim() {
"" | "d" => n,
"w" => n.checked_mul(7)?,
"mo" => n.checked_mul(30)?,
"y" => n.checked_mul(365)?,
_ => return None,
};
Some(Duration::days(days))
}
#[cfg(test)]
mod tests {
use super::*;
#[test]
fn bare_number_means_days() {
assert_eq!(parse_age("7"), Some(Duration::days(7)));
}
#[test]
fn days_suffix() {
assert_eq!(parse_age("30d"), Some(Duration::days(30)));
}
#[test]
fn weeks_suffix() {
assert_eq!(parse_age("2w"), Some(Duration::days(14)));
}
#[test]
fn months_suffix() {
assert_eq!(parse_age("3mo"), Some(Duration::days(90)));
}
#[test]
fn years_suffix() {
assert_eq!(parse_age("1y"), Some(Duration::days(365)));
}
#[test]
fn rejects_negative() {
assert_eq!(parse_age("-5d"), None);
}
#[test]
fn rejects_unknown_unit() {
assert_eq!(parse_age("5h"), None);
assert_eq!(parse_age("5foo"), None);
}
#[test]
fn rejects_empty() {
assert_eq!(parse_age(""), None);
assert_eq!(parse_age(" "), None);
}
#[test]
fn rejects_nonsense() {
assert_eq!(parse_age("abc"), None);
assert_eq!(parse_age("d"), None);
}
}
